Balancing Readability and Style
One common concern with display fonts is readability. While Joined Tightly is expressive, it is crucial to use it wisely. This font shines best as a headline, accent font, or short burst of text. It is not designed for long paragraphs of body copy. For those sections, pair it with a clean, highly readable sans serif font or a classic serif font. This contrast ensures that your audience can easily digest information while still enjoying the visual appeal of your branding.
For example, if you are designing a product label for a skincare line, use Joined Tightly for the product name and brand logo. Then, switch to a simple, neutral typeface for the ingredients list and usage instructions. This hierarchy guides the eye and ensures that critical information is never lost in style. Always test your designs on mobile screens and in print. What looks good on a large monitor might need adjustment when printed on a small sticker or viewed on a smartphone thumbnail.
Smart Font Pairing Strategies
To get the most out of Joined Tightly, consider these pairing ideas that maintain professional aesthetics:
- With a Geometric Sans Serif: This combination feels modern and clean. It is perfect for tech startups, contemporary cafes, or minimalist fashion brands.
- With a Traditional Serif: Pairing this display font with a traditional serif adds a touch of heritage and sophistication. This works well for law firms, consultancies, or luxury goods.
- With a Simple Handwritten Font: If you want a more personal touch, pair it with a subtle handwritten accent for signatures or small notes. However, ensure the handwritten font does not compete for attention.
Remember, the goal of font pairing is harmony, not competition. Let Joined Tightly be the star of the show while supporting fonts play the role of reliable narrators.
Testing and Licensing Best Practices
Before rolling out Joined Tightly across your entire brand, conduct a thorough test. Print sample labels, view your website on different devices, and ask for feedback from your target demographic. Does the font convey the right emotion? Is it legible at smaller sizes? These small steps prevent costly rebrands later.
Additionally, always verify the commercial licensing terms. As a business owner, you must ensure that your license covers all intended uses, including packaging design, merchandise, client work, and digital downloads. Using a commercial font correctly protects your business from legal issues and supports the designers who create these valuable tools. Investing in proper licensing is part of building a sustainable and ethical business.
